@jcsuperstaruk: In 1990, Microsoft presented Excel as something close to a workplace miracle. Features such as AutoFill, drag and drop, and automatic formatting promised to remove repetitive steps from everyday office work. Tasks that once required constant manual entry and adjustment could suddenly be completed in moments. Microsoft was not simply selling spreadsheet software. It was selling time, accuracy, and a vision of the computer as an essential office tool. What looked revolutionary then is now so familiar that most people barely notice it.
